PhilNDebbieAtSea Posted December 28, 2015 Author #185 Share Posted December 28, 2015 We stopped in Paia for lunch. We were starving because we hadn’t had breakfast. We told Butch that we felt like burgers – cruise ships just don’t have good burgers usually. He suggested these 2 restaurants on the main street – Charley’s Restaurant and Saloon and Rock and Brew. We went with the Rock and Brew as it was more open and neither place had air conditioning. Maui – the land of very little air conditioning.
